The Terra Select T5 is a machine built by Terra Select. Production: 2008-2015. The machine is 10,980 mm long and 2,600 mm wide. The unladen weight is 15,110 kg. The wheelbase measures 7,000 mm. Top speed is 100 km/h. The gross vehicle weight is 15,400 kg. Unladen weight across the Terra Select range ranges from 10,850 to 24,280 kg; the T5 sits in the lower part of that range with 15,110 kg. Its immediate neighbours are the T 5 below it with 14,840 kg and the T55 above it with 15,160 kg. 15 Terra Select models are on record. What to check before buying

  • Search the frame and welds at the axle mounts — that is where cracks start.
  • Check the brakes and the last inspection in the papers.
  • Work the gross weight against the towing vehicle before buying.
  • Compare the chassis number with the papers.
  • Look at the floor, cover or body from the inside — rust does not show from outside.

A general list for this type of machine — no substitute for an inspection or an appraiser.
